    "content": "This is incorrect. This would be true for V/u but is reverse for U/v as\nDoppler is making the apparent received frequency at the satellite higher\nas the satellite is flying towards the ground based transmitter.\n\n73,\nGabe\nAL6D/VE6NJH\n\nOn Wed, Jun 6, 2018, 8:14 PM Daniel Wight <[email protected]> wrote:\n\n> Seems like your Doppler shift might be opposite. I normally start high &\n> work my way down during the satellite pass... (For instance, I would start\n> at 435.180 for AO-85 and then work my way down to 435.160 as the satellite\n> 'sunsets' on my horizon). Doppler shift should be higher frequency during\n> approach, near zero when the satellite is overhead, and lower after the\n> satellite passes.\n>\n> 73,\n>\n> Daniel, KD7LEE\n>\n> On Wed, Jun 6, 2018, 17:27 Andrew Glasbrenner <[email protected]>\n> wrote:\n>\n> > You've discovered one of the reasons full duplex is best on the FM\n> > sats...you have no idea if you are getting through, because you can't\n> hear\n> > while transmitting.\n> >\n> > Got another radio so you can work full duplex?\n> >\n> > 73, Drew KO4MA\n> >\n> > -----Original Message-----\n> > From: AMSAT-BB <[email protected]> On Behalf Of Hugo Dominguez,\n> > Jr.\n> > Sent: Wednesday, June 06, 2018 7:41 PM\n> > To: [email protected]\n> > Subject: [amsat-bb] Unsuccessful Uplinks - AO-92\n> >\n> > I’ve just started playing with talking on satellites. I’m able to hear\n> all\n> > the satellites (AO-85, AO-91, AO-92 and SO-50) that I have programmed on\n> my\n> > Kenwood TH-D74, which I use with my Elk dual band periodic log antenna.\n> > However no one can hear me or responds to me. I’ve only been successful\n> > with my uplink (being heard) on AO-91 on several passes. I triple checked\n> > my frequencies on my radio and the 67 Hz tone and they are set as\n> follows:\n> > Sat.        Xmit       Tone\n> > SO-50   145.850  67.0 Hz\n> > AO-85   435.170  67.0 Hz\n> > AO-91   435.250  67.0 HZ\n> > AO-92   435.350  67.0 Hz\n> > These are the frequencies used when the bird is at its peak. I adjust for\n> > doppler on 440 by starting out 10 khz less, e.g AO-85 435.160, 435.165,\n> > 435.170, 435.175, 435.180.\n> >\n> > Any ideas if something has changed from what is published or am I missing\n> > something?
